All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Hillside Crescent area has the 32nd lowest crime rate of 94 local areas in Corby Rural , and the 427th lowest crime rate of 1,080 local areas in North Northamptonshire .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Hillside Crescent (NN17 3HG) in the last 12 months was 45.3 per 1,000 residents and was 59.1% lower than the Corby Rural average (110.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 8 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 700.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2024.
Violent crimes totalled 5 (≈ 12.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 400.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-59.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Hillside Crescent (NN17 3HG), the main crime hotspot is near Hillside Crescent. Police recorded 9 crimes here, including 3 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
